EVALUASI PERTUMBUHAN DAN PRODUKSI AKSESI JAGUNG MANIS UNGU GENERASI F1 HASIL PERSILANGAN VARIETAS BIMMO DENGAN JAGUNG UNGU UNSRI
This study aims to produce growth, production, segregation, and selection of several purple sweet corn accessions (UJ3UBM and BM) and produce the next generation of seeds. It was carried out in Sepang Village, Pampangan District, Ogan Komering Ilir Regency, South Sumatra Province, in June-October 2024, with a randomized block plan of three cross blocks, a spacing of 80 on x 40 on. Data were analyzed using Anova at α 5% with the SAS program. The results showed that the F1 generation could grow well, producing baby corn, sweet corn, and F2 seeds. Seed color was segregated into white and purple. The average height of sweet corn plants was 228.1 cm, baby corn 215.5 cm, the height of the sweet corn cob was 112 an, baby corn and purple sweet corn was 36 days after planting, and the age of flowering in purple baby corn was 41 days after planting. Purple baby corn was harvested at 50 days after planting with a fresh weight of 43.93 g per ear and a sugar content of 7.9% Brix. Purple sweet corn was harvested at 65 days after planting with a fresh weight of 237.8 g per ear and a sugar content of 8.9% Brix. Purple corn seeds had a sugar content of 7.5%. nineteen purple ears with a clear seed coat were obtained, subtable for further variety development research.
